Panterpe insignis
Least ConcernAves · Apodiformes · Trochilidae
The fiery-throated hummingbird is a species of hummingbird in the "mountain gems" tribe Lampornithini in subfamily Trochilinae. It is found in Costa Rica and Panama.

In northern and north-central Costa Rica it occurs at elevations from 1,600 m (5,250 ft) to summits at up to 2,000 m (6,560 ft); further south in higher mountains it ranges between 2,200 and 3,200 m (7,220 and 10,500 ft).
Habitat
Occurs in more open landscapes like the lower edge of páramo, secondary forest, and pastures with many trees.
Diet
Feeds on nectar taken from a variety of small flowers, including those of epiphytic Ericaceae, bromeliads, shrubs, and small trees.
